_D_e_s_c_r_i_p_t_i_o_n:

     Converts continuous probability values into binned discrete
     probability forecasts.  This is useful in calculated Brier type
     scores for values with continuous probabilities. Each probability
     is assigned the value of the midpoint.

_U_s_a_g_e:

         probcont2disc(x, bins = seq(0,1,0.1) )
            

_A_r_g_u_m_e_n_t_s:

       x: A vector of probabilities

    bins: Bins.  Defaults to 0 to 1 by 0.1 .

_V_a_l_u_e:

     A vector of discrete probabilities.  E

_N_o_t_e:

     This function is used within 'brier'.

_E_x_a_m_p_l_e_s:

     #  probabilistic/ binary example

     set.seed(1)
     x <- runif(10) ## simulated probabilities.

     probcont2disc(x)
     probcont2disc(x, bins = seq(0,1,0.25) )

     ## probcont2disc(4, bins = seq(0,1,0.3)) ## gets error
